Joshua Wolf Shenk

    Joshua Wolf Shenk je esejista a riaditeľ Literárneho domu Rose O'Neill na Washington College. Jeho dielo sa vyznačuje hlbokým skúmaním ľudskej psychiky, najmä v kontexte histórie a spoločenských problémov. Shenk sa zameriava na prepojenie osobnej skúsenosti s širšími kultúrnymi a psychologickými naratívmi, pričom jeho štýl je analytický a zároveň pútavý.

      Drawing on a wealth of his own research and the work of other Lincoln scholars, Shenk reveals how the sixteenth president harnessed his depression to fuel his astonishing success. Lincoln found the solace and tactics he needed to deal with the nation's worst crisis in the coping strategies he developed over a lifetime of persevering through depressive episodes and personal tragedies. With empathy and authority gained from his own experience with depression, Shenk crafts a nuanced, revelatory account of Lincoln and his legacy, and in the process unveils a wholly new perspective on how our greatest president guided America through its greatest turmoil.
